- Get The Placement of Your Brows. An important step in forming your brows is to know its exact placement. Use your finger to feel where exactly your brow bones are – it’s the ridge that’s between your eye socket and lower forehead. Your eyebrows should directly sit over this bone and all there’s left to do is to tweeze the hair that fell beyond your brow bones. Work back and forth between your brows though, to ensure that they are evenly done.
- Subtly Shape Your Arch. In shaping your brows, make your arch two-thirds on the way out of your brow bone. Reveal a bit of your brow bones at first, keeping your brows a little thicker, since you’ll still be able to remove more hair later if you want to.
- Deal With Gaps and Scars. If you have any eyebrow gaps or scars in the brow area, use an eyebrow pencil to create short strokes in the direction of your hair growth and then blend it using a spoolie. Experts also advised to pick your pencil shade based on the darkest part of your brows, which is in the mid-area of your eyebrows.
- Set Your Eyebrow Look. In setting your eyebrows, use a flexible-hold brow gel to ensure that they stay flawless and in place throughout the day.
